HUE will replace the investor and terminate the contract with the weak contractor, causing the key traffic project of To Huu extended road to Phu Bai airport to be delayed.
The To Huu extended road project to Phu Bai airport (Hue City) is under slow construction progress. The investor has repeatedly fined the contractor for not ensuring the progress according to the contract.Recorded by Lao Dong Newspaper reporters on the afternoon of July 5, there are still many unfinished construction sections on the entire route that have not been deployed synchronously.At package No. 21, many sections of the roadbed have only been filled with sand and soil for a part and then construction has stopped, and continuous connection is not possible. The work undertaken by Dong Tam Group Joint Stock Company is the slowest area, many locations are still messy, with water holes and soft soil appearing.Some overpasses on the route are being implemented by contractors, and the shape of the project is gradually becoming clear.Machinery is gathered at the construction site, but the number of workers directly constructing is still quite small.Bridge pillars are being constructed at many locations on the route, serving the connection of road sections through the field area.The geological conditions with a lot of mud and water make the treatment of the soil foundation and construction encounter many difficulties.Many sections of the route are covered with technical tarpaulins to serve weak soil treatment before deploying subsequent items.Strengthen the implementation of construction in areas with weak soil foundations.Many locations on the route are still not connected between construction sections, causing the ground to be still disjointed.The starting point of the project in Zone E - An Van Duong New Urban Area has not yet been implemented.The entire project still has many items to accelerate progress to ensure the goal of completion according to plan.
The To Huu extended road to Phu Bai airport project was approved by Hue City People's Committee in 2023 with a total investment of 1,143 billion VND, a length of about 9.59km, starting point at Zone E - An Van Duong new urban area and ending point connecting Thuan Hoa road intersection with National Highway 1 (Phu Bai ward). The project was started on January 20, 2025, with a implementation time of 4 years.
For package No. 21, the work undertaken by Dong Tam Group Joint Stock Company is worth about 196 billion VND. During the construction process, this contractor was fined twice by the investor with a total amount of 411 million VND for violating the contract progress. After many urging but failing to rectify, the Hue City Urban Development and Construction Investment Project Management Board issued a decision to terminate the contract, and at the same time carried out procedures to confiscate more than 10 billion VND of contract performance guarantee money and recover more than 38 billion VND of unpaid advance money.
To remove obstacles and accelerate the project progress, Hue City People's Committee has agreed on the policy of transferring the project investor from the Project Management Board for Construction Investment and Urban Development to the Project Management Board for Construction Investment Area 3, and at the same time requested to complete the handling of existing problems related to contractors before July 10, 2026.
